We Speak NYC (formerly We Are New York) is the city’s free English Language Learning program, created and managed by the Mayor’s Office of Immigrant Affairs. We provide civic-focused instruction through videos, web and print materials, and free community classes in all five boroughs.

The We Speak NYC team works together to train and support volunteers, organize classes, form partnerships with community organizations and create content for our learners. We are an almost entirely volunteer-led program. We welcome new volunteers and partners to the program.

WSNYC has engaged with 200+ partner sites and trained 700+ volunteers. These volunteers have facilitated over 750 conversation classes for a total of 24.5K hours of service and over 15,000 learners reached.
